Output 3f60d6f392791bf2330fac3b1a4201b4e2218cfd95f3b6b00484d3d585277440:1

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39117c3eadefdd1fbedb809204fda7efa4f5d23039aec85a23b339a7aa14a29b
address
bc1p8yghc04dalw3l0kmszfqfld8a7j0t53s8xhvsk3rkvu602s552ds6fj8qn
transaction
3f60d6f392791bf2330fac3b1a4201b4e2218cfd95f3b6b00484d3d585277440
spent
true